AM: the government is striving to stimulate the market for quality beers
In addition to maintaining the dynamic development of the beer sector, the government is striving to stimulate the market of quality beers and widen the segment of craft beers – Zsigó Róbert, Minister of State of the Ministry of Agriculture (AM) responsible for Food Chain Supervision said on Wednesday, at a press conference in Budapest, heralding the 13th International Beer Competition and Beer Muster.
He added that the Association of Small Breweries (KSE), which currently consists of 54 brewers, organizes numerous festivals to promote beer and cultured alcohol consumption The most important festival is the International Beer Competition and Beer Muster, the implementation of which is supported by the Ministry of Agriculture. Gyenge Zsolt, president of the KSE, explained that 85 brewers from 9 countries had sent their beer to the association’s beer competition so far. (MTI)
